Job Description:
Job responsibilities include (but are not limited to):

  • Follow work instructions
  • Ensure proper understanding of the required actions
  • Accurately complete administration requirements
  • Report to supervisor on completion of task
  • Identify and report all irregularities to Supervisor
  • Apply recognized work, legislative and security standards • Ensure that security tasks are completed to required standards
  • Conduct allocated patrols or checkpoint duties including adhoc security assignment
  • Assist with crowd management during community unrest or other emergency situations
  • Conducts dog handing activities where applicable
  • Competent to drive security vehicle as required
  • Gather information that could assist with security Act risk management
  • Take appropriate when security risk situation is observed.
  • Respond to security alarms and take appropriate action
  • Enforce and monitor access controls
  • Conduct surveillance activities to support investigation when required
  • Effective use of allocated equipment
  • Effective two-way communications with team members and visitors
  • Promote security awareness
  • Maintains facilities, equipment and personal image
  • Participate in required meetings
  • Gathers information on crime and risks
  • Arrest all identified transgressors
  • Give evidence during disciplinary enquiries or criminal cases
  • Supports and assist Patrolpersons

Qualifications:

  • Grade 12 or grade 10 for employees with 10 years or more service within PS
  • Handle and use a Shotgun for Business Purposes
  • PSIRA Armed responses course
  • Registered with the PSIRA grade C
  • Valid driver’s licence code B and Company Drivers licence will be advantageous
  • Code B Armoured Vehicle driving course will be advantageous

Experience:

  • 2 years’ experience in Security environment or equivalent
  • Supervisory experience will be advantageous

Knowledge and Skills:

  • Computer literacy
  • Counter Industrial Action practical
  • Applicable SAPS firearm competency
  • Communications in English (spoken, written and reading)
  • Writing of statements and opening of a case docket
  • Handling of various emergency situations
  • Good working relations
  • Psychometric Assessment for firearm users
  • No criminal record
  • Pass polygraph test
  • Protection Services Induction
  • Voluntary Principles on Security and Human Rights
  • Use of Force Procedure
  • AAP Rules of engagement
